Last updated Feb 23, 2021 0 This Article Is About How Solid Is Your Lenders Pre-Approval Letter For Home Purchase How Solid Is Your Lenders Pre-Approval? This is often a key question among not just homebuyers but home sellers and realtors The Pre-Approval Stage is the most important phase of the mortgage process The number one reason why borrowers go through stress during the mortgage process is that they were properly not qualified by their loan officers The reason for last-minute loan denials is due to not being pre-approved correctly Or because the loan officer issued a hasty pre-approval without properly doing his or her due diligence In this article, we will discuss and cover How Solid Is Your Lenders Pre-Approval Letter For Home Purchase. How Long Does The Pre-Approval Process Take There are many borrowers who want a pre-approval within minutes of them getting pre-qualified. However, if you want your loan process to go smoothly, then you need to cooperate with the loan officer Make sure that the loan officer has all grounds completed There is no set time on how long a pre-approval letter takes.

However, if you don't pass the soft credit check, your application will be denied. Make a decision: You can either accept the pre-approval offer or deny it. Lenders differ on how long a pre-approval lasts, but it likely won't last longer than a month. Provide documentation: If you accept the offer, you'll need to provide documents that prove your income, employment and/or assets, as well as personal information like your Social Security number. The process to apply for a pre-approval is pretty straightforward, but there are some things you need to keep in mind when browsing for and accepting a personal loan officer. Do Shop Around Don't go with the first lender that offers you pre-approval. Shop around and see what kinds of loans are out there. We recommend applying for personal loan pre-approvals from banks, credit unions, lending aggregators (like LendingTree), peer-to-peer lenders (like LendingClub), and specialized lenders (like SoFi). Cast as wide of a net as you can. There's no limit to the number of pre-approvals you can apply for.

Keep in mind that a pre-approval isn't a promise. "It doesn't guarantee you'll be approved, " says Tara Alderete, director of enterprise learning at Money Management International, a nonprofit financial counseling and education agency. "If you obtain a pre-approval and something changes [to your income or credit report], you can still be denied for that loan, " says Alderete. How to Apply For Pre-Approval Generally, here is the process of applying for a personal loan pre-approval. Fill out the form for pre-approval on a lender's website: You'll be asked about your income, employment, and debt, but you won't need to provide documented proof at this point. The lender performs a soft credit pull: The lender will be looking at your credit report — including your payment history — and sussing out whether you're a trustworthy borrower. Receive a pre-approval offer, if you qualify: If you qualify for a pre-approval, the lender will extend a personal loan offer, which will include the maximum loan amount it's willing to extend, the interest rate, and all other loan terms.
